Description:
Aesthetic qualities and values investigation, materials and technology, the evolution and use of historic building protection law
This seminar will cover the history of current legislative frameworks and their use in practice:
-
William Morris and his early influence
-
Scheduled Ancient Monuments, Listed Buildings and their grading
Current and proposed primary legislation.
The speaker with also discuss:
-
Current secondary legislation and practice guides
-
EH's Conservation Principles, Policies and Guidance
-
Archive selection and research
-
Assembling the knowledge gained and translating it into design, writing persuasive design and historic impact statements in the interests of fine architecture.
